What's The Definition Of Lubricant?

[n] a substance capable of reducing friction by making surfaces smooth or slippery

Synonyms | Synonyms for Lubricant: lubricating substance | lubricator

Lubricant In Webster's Dictionary

\Lu"bri*cant\, a. [L. lubricans, p. pr. of lubricare, See {Lubricate}.] Lubricating.
\Lu"bri*cant\, n. That which lubricates; specifically, a substance, as oil, grease, plumbago, etc., used for reducing the friction of the working parts of machinery.
